We booked this aparthotel for a 5 night stay in Cannes. The hotel was situated about 10 minutes walk from the public beach which is free. The town is between 5 and 20 minutes walk depending on how far along the Croisette that you go. The apartment we had was a one-bedroomed, 4 person apartment. There was a twin bedroom,... more

My wife, daughter and I stayed here for five nights over the New Year 2006. The basic but clean and spacious apartment was extremely good value for money. Hotel is very conveniently located, just 10 minutes walk from the port and with a good small supermarket close by as well as an excellent baker/patisserie. Staff were friendly and welcoming.
